Vully Deekshith Kumar has been competing for 9 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 10.91, set at Hyderabad Cube Open 2018, puts him in the top 10.2%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 1,170th in India. Across 2 competitions since September 2017, he has put 47 official solves on the record across five events. Vully has entered two competitions.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
